Services available in Bainbridge Island
- Stretcher transport: Recumbent stretcher service for passengers who must remain flat or semi-reclined on the road out of Bainbridge Island, WA, with continuous attendant support.
- Wheelchair transport: ADA-oriented wheelchair vehicles for secure long-haul travel to and from Bainbridge Island, WA, including door-through-door assistance when appropriate.
- Ambulatory support: Assisted ambulatory transport for riders who can walk short distances but need supervision and comfort management across multi-hour Bainbridge Island, WA itineraries.

Frequently asked questions
How far in advance should we book transport involving Bainbridge Island, Washington?
Most families schedule Bainbridge Island, Washington long-distance trips several days ahead so vehicle type, staffing, and facility windows can be confirmed. Urgent discharge coordination is still possible when capacity allows.
Can a family member ride along from Bainbridge Island, Washington?
Companion policies depend on vehicle configuration and passenger needs. Share companion requests when you request a quote so we can match the right vehicle.
Do you only transport within Bainbridge Island, Washington?
No. Bainbridge Island, Washington is a service origin or destination—our core work is long-distance non-emergency transport across the continental United States, often crossing multiple states in a single itinerary.
